Boutique hires ex-AmEx fund managers

Singapore''s Heritage Capital bolsters its team after American Express relocates investment management.

A Singapore-based boutique fund manager, Heritage Capital Management, has hired two fund managers who had lost their jobs when their employer, American Express Asset Management, relocated investment management out of Asia earlier this year.

Heritage is a long-only Asian equities specialist with $30 million of assets under management. Its founder, Chan Wing-Cheng, bolstered his firm's team to help grow the business and attract more assets, with a view that Asian equities will become an increasingly attractive asset class for global investors.

The two hires, Tan Poh-Hong and Lim Ser-Mui, both managed regional portfolios for AmEx in Singapore. AmEx relocated its investment management capability from Hong Kong and Singapore to London, where it recently acquired UK fund house Threadneedle. Both Tan and Lim will divide up Asian country portfolios and work with Chan, who has run the business solo since founding it in 1997. Prior to that he ran Singapore sales, research and operations at WI Carr. Christina Leong Shau-Ling handles Heritage's marketing.
